1. Boil the potatoes in their skins in lightly salted water until tender. Allow the potatoes to cool until you can handle them. Peel the potatoes and slice them into 1/4 inch slices. Put the sliced potatoes in a large mixing bowl and set aside.
2. Add onions, beef broth, vinegar, salt, pepper, sugar, and mustard in a medium saucepan and bring to a boil. As soon as it boils, remove from heat and pour the mixture over the potatoes. Cover the bowl of potatoes and let sit for at least one hour.
3. After at least one hour, gently stir in the oil and season with salt and pepper to taste. If too much liquid remains, use a slotted spoon to serve. Serve garnished with fresh chopped chives. Serve at room temperature. Note: This potato salad is best the next day (remove from fridge at least 30 minutes before serving).

1. Scrub the potatoes and place them in a pot large enough to hold them all comfortably. Add salt generously as salt will increase the flavor of the potatoes.
2. Bring to a boil, turn the heat to low, and simmer the potatoes until tender. Start checking after 5 minutes already if the potatoes are very small. Otherwise, depending on their size, the potatoes will need between 10 and 15 minutes of cooking time.
3. Drain well, rinse with cold water and leave for about 5 minutes to cool down slightly. Peel the potatoes while they are still hot. Slice them and place them in a large bowl.
4. Take a small handful of the cooked potatoes and keep them separately in a small bowl, you will need them to make the dressing for the German potato salad.

1. Scrub the potatoes clean and cook until fork tender. If you have an Instant Pot pressure cooker, I steam mine with 1 cup water for about 10 minute. Drain and set aside until just cool enough to handle without burning your hands. To peel the potatoes, easily, use a clean tea towel and firmly hold one potato. With the other hand, use your thumbs to press and pull away the peel. Easy peasy!
2. Slice each potato in half and then but into 1/4" slices into a bowl. Set aside.
3. In a pan, add the onion, broth, salt and pepper, mustard, sugar and vinegar and bring to a boil. Immediately turn off the heat and pour the mixture over the potatoes.NOTE: I add half of the mixture, at first, to make sure that my potatoes are swimming in dressing. You can always add more dressing, but if you add too much you'll have to drain some of it (spoken from experience).

1. Place whole, peeled potatoes in a pot and cover with water. Bring the water to a boil over high heat. Reduce the heat and simmer the potatoes until just barely fork tender (10 - 15 min).
2. Once the potatoes are cooked, drain them and let them cool slightly.
3. While the potatoes are cooling, mix the hot beef broth, vinegar, mustard, sugar, salt, and white pepper together in a small saucepan. Bring the mixture to a simmer over medium low heat.
4. By now, the potatoes should be cool enough to handle. Slice them into ¼ inch slices and place the sliced potatoes into a medium bowl. Add the onions and hot beef broth mixture. Mix well.
